GE Digital Energy Educates Customers with Interactive Video Wall

GE-web1-0214Located at GE Digital Energy’s new Canadian Headquarters in Markham, Ontario, Canada, the Customer Experience Center (CEC) is a facility promoting GE’s energy grid solutions. The CEC features a 175-tile, 60-foot curved Prysm LPD video wall, Extron Quantum Elite Processor, control by the presenter’s iPad/wall-mounted Crestron, powerful multi-zoned audio system and touch panels.

Background

GE envisioned an Experience Center within its new Canadian headquarters that would mirror the company’s passion for energy, technology and efficiency. The CEC is an interactive environment that educates GE’s customers on the company’s solutions.

The space, which required a wow-factor, features a large immersive digital display with no visible seams. The display needed to consume minimal power (as an organization focused on energy) and great viewing-angles (due to size). Advanced integrated a low-power digital signage system from Prysm using Laser-Phosphor-Display (LPD). The 60-foot curved LPD video wall is the first of its kind in the world.

When entering the CEC, interactive-kiosks explain the digital energy story. The video wall is also interactive and driven by the presenter’s iPad. A multi-zoned audio system was added to bring the content to life. Upon exiting the CEC, guests — using their ID passes — can instantly upload contact information to a touchscreen for follow-up.
